Job description

Adams & Martin Group is in search of a seasoned Real Estate Paralegal to join a prestigious client's team. This role is perfect for individuals who are detail-oriented, highly organized, and possess the ability to manage multiple responsibilities in a fast-paced environment.

Real Estate Paralegal Opportunity
Responsibilities:
  • Draft and review real estate contracts, purchase agreements, leases, deeds, title affidavits, closing documents, and other legal forms.
  • Conduct thorough title and survey review to verify property ownership and identify any liens, encumbrances, and other legal issues affecting the title.
  • Communicate with clients, providing updates on transaction status, addressing questions, and gathering necessary information.
  • Research relevant real estate laws, regulations, and case precedents to ensure compliance.
  • Manage the closing process, coordinating with lenders, title companies, and other parties to ensure all necessary documents are prepared and executed on time.
  • Perform due diligence checks on properties, including reviewing property reports, zoning reports, and environmental assessments.
  • Maintain accurate and organized client files, including electronic records.
  • Stay updated on legal requirements and ensure all real estate transactions comply with local, state, and federal regulations.
  • Prepare documents or proofread documents prepared by the attorney.
  • Prepare related entity documents, including resolutions authorizing the transaction.
  • Accurately record time worked and enter time and description into time and billing system.
